For D-antigen quantitation, we have developed the VaxArray Polio Assay Kit, a multiplexed, microarray-based immunoassay that uses poliovirus-specific human monoclonal antibodies currently under consideration as standardized reagents for characterizing inactivated Sabin and Salk vaccines. The VaxArray assay can simultaneously quantify all 3 poliovirus serotypes with a time to result of less than 3 h. Here we demonstrate that the assay has limits of quantification suitable for both bioprocess samples and final vaccines, excellent reproducibility and precision, and improved accuracy over an analogous plate-based ELISA. In this work, we investigated how the two major components of bee venom, melittin and phospholipase A2 (PLA2), achieve activation by such membrane remodeling. Their membrane-disrupting functions have been reported to increase when both are present, but the mechanism of this synergism had not been established. Using membrane reconstitution, we found that melittin can form large-scale membrane deformities upon which PLA2 activity is 25-fold higher. Tracking of single-molecule PLA2 revealed that its processive behavior on these deformities underlies the enhanced activity. These results show how melittin and PLA2 work synergistically to enhance the lytic effects of the bee venom. Here, we identify steps in the conductance activation pathway of Kv2.1 channels that are modulated by AMIGO1 using voltage-clamp recordings and spectroscopy of heterologously expressed Kv2.1 and AMIGO1 in mammalian cell lines. AMIGO1 speeds early voltage-sensor movements and shifts the gating charge-voltage relationship to more negative voltages. The gating charge-voltage relationship indicates that AMIGO1 exerts a larger energetic effect on voltage-sensor movement than is apparent from the midpoint of the conductance-voltage relationship. When voltage sensors are detained at rest by voltage-sensor toxins, AMIGO1 has a greater impact on the conductance-voltage relationship. Fluorescence measurements from voltage-sensor toxins bound to Kv2.1 indicate that with AMIGO1, the voltage sensors enter their earliest resting conformation, yet this conformation is less stable upon voltage stimulation. The ever-pervasive demand for greater quality healthcare while curbing costs mandates laboratory stewardship utilizing the most robust testing strategies, including PARRI, to guide patient management. Clinical and medical biochemists are well positioned to guide such additive testing strategies by performing such maneuvers as scrutiny of selected test results, determination of potential adjunctive testing and provision of result interpretation. Significant practice variation exists between laboratories however, including the scope, threshold, and choice of test add-ons and whether the process is reflexive or reflective. Compounding the issue, cost effectiveness of some of these interventions has been sparsely reported. Calls for standardization and scalability have posited artificial intelligence (AI) as the frontier of additive testing. This review article examines each of these aspects and summarizes the evidence supporting PARRI and the related challenges. The gold standard treatment for high-risk NMIBC is BCG immunotherapy. Some studies suggested an immomodulatory effects for commonly used drugs (ie, ACE-I and ARBs). We aimed to determine whether these drugs impact the prognosis of patients with high-risk NMIBC treated with BCG.

Retrospective analysis on 208 patients from a single academic center with primary high-risk NMIBC treated with transurethral resection followed by 6 weekly instillations of BCG and up to 12 monthly maintenance instillations. ARBs or ACE-I use at the time of treatment initiation was recorded. Inverse probability of treatment weighting (IPTW) was used to adjust for clinical and pathological covariates. IPTW-adjusted Kaplan-Meier curves and weighted Cox proportional hazards regression were used to compare 2-yr failure-free (2-yr FFS), failure-free (FFS), overall recurrence-free (RFS) and progression-free survival (PFS).

A total of 68 patients were on ACE-I, and 38 on ARBs and treatment respectively. At a median follow-up of 26 months, ACE-I treatment had no significant impact on cancer-related outcomes. Conversely, patients treated with ARBs experienced significant improvements in 2-yr FFS (HR 0.3; 0.1-0.9, P=.004), FFS (HR 0.4, 0.1-0.9, P=.005), and PFS (HR 0.001; < 0.001-0.001, P < .001). No significant impact was found for ARB use in RFS (HR 0.6; P=.09). Sensitivity analyses confirmed these results.

our findings support a potential role of the angiotensin-renin system in bladder cancer development. We identified ARBs as potential beneficial drugs that seems to act in synergy with BCG-immunotherapy.

The aim of the study was to elucidate the predictive and prognostic value of serum gamma-glutamyltransferase (GGT) in patients with invasive bladder cancer (BC).

Preoperative serum GGT concentrations were assessed in 324 patients treated with RC for cM0 BC between 2002 and 2013. Laboratory values were obtained 1 to 3 days prior to RC. Uni- and multivariable analyses were carried out to evaluate clinicopathologic risk factors for survival. The median follow-up was 36 months (IQR 10-55).

Elevated preoperative GGT levels were diagnosed in 77 patients (23.8%). Elevated GGT was significantly associated with higher ECOG PS and tumor stage (both P= .001), lymph-node tumor involvement (P < .001), positive surgical margins (P= .018), lymphovascular invasion (P= .024), muscle-invasive disease at primary diagnosis (P= .033), increased tumor size (P= .035), hydronephrosis at RC (P= .049) and increased preoperative CRP, GPT and GOT levels (both P < .001). Patients with elevated GGT had decreased 3-year overall (49.2% vs. 69.6%; P= .005) and cancer-specific survival (71.1% vs. 80.9%; P= .042) compared with patients with normal levels. On multivariable analysis, advanced tumor stage (P= .032), lymph node positive disease (P= .030), positive soft tissue surgical margins (P= .014), hydronephrosis at RC (both P= .010), higher ECOG performance status and elevated GGT (P= .043) levels were independent predictors of all-cause mortality.

Elevated preoperative serum GGT levels are associated with increased risk of locally advanced BC and mortality after RC. These data suggest that GGT levels may be useful for improved prognostication in invasive BC.

To analyse the performance of a Shared Decision Making (SDM) intervention, we assessed perceived and experienced SDM in General Practitioners (GPs) and patients with type 2 diabetes (T2DM).

Cluster-Randomised Controlled Trial (cRCT) testing the effect of a decision aid. Opinions and experienced role regarding SDM were assessed in 72 patients and 18 GPs with the SDM-Q-9 (range 0-45) and Control Preferences Scale (CPS, 0-5), and observed SDM with the OPTION5 (0-20). SDM at baseline was compared to 24 months' follow-up using paired t-tests.

At baseline, perceived levels of SDM did not significantly differ between GPs and patients with T2DM (difference of 2.3, p = 0.24). At follow-up, mean patients' perceived level of SDM was 7.9 lower compared to baseline (p < 0.01), whereas GPs' opinions had not changed significantly. After both visits, mean CPS scores differed significantly between patients and GPs. OPTION5 scores ranged between 6 and 20.

Patients and GPs perceived similar baseline levels of SDM. Two years later, patients perceived less SDM, while GPs did not change their opinion. SDM was appropriate immediately after training, but perhaps GPs fell back in old habits over time. We recommend repeated SDM training.

PHC is associated with a poor prognosis because of its insidious local spread that makes it challenging to diagnose and assess. Surgical resection remains the standard curative treatment (up to 50% 5-year overall survival after negative-margin resection). More aggressive surgical approaches have recently emerged, pushing the boundaries of PHC resectability at the cost of a higher morbidity. As such, adequate preoperative preparation (i.e., biliary drainage, venous embolization) is now regarded as a critical issue to increase the number of patients amenable to extended liver resection. Thorough imaging plays a pivotal role in the preoperative setting in both PHC resectability assessment and patient preparation to surgery. Despite recent improvement in PHC imaging, its assessment remains challenging and only 50-60% of patients who are scheduled to undergo surgery are ultimately amenable to curative resection. Therefore, a knowledge of available diagnostic and interventional imaging techniques is important to improve PHC management. Herein, we review the various imaging techniques and preoperative radiological interventions such as biliary drainage, portal vein embolization and liver venous deprivation that are available in PHC management focusing on the anatomical and oncological considerations that are crucial to prepare and guide curative surgical resection.
